آموزش جامع برنامه نویسی پنل زیمنس

آموزش جامع برنامه نویسی پنل زیمنس

پنل های زیمنس (HMI: Human Machine Interface) یکی از ابزارهای کلیدی در اتوماسیون صنعتی هستند که به اپراتورها و مهندسان اجازه میدهند وضعیت تجهیزات صنعتی را نظارت کرده و آنها را کنترل کنند. برنامه نویسی صحیح این پنل ها، تضمین کننده عملکرد بهینه و بدون خطای تجهیزات است.

در این مقاله، با رویکردی جامع و علمی، آموزش برنامه نویسی پنل های زیمنس را ارائه میکنیم و شما را با مفاهیم، ابزارها و مراحل کار آشنا میکنیم.

پنل زیمنس چیست و چرا به برنامه نویسی نیاز دارد؟

پنل های HMI زیمنس رابط کاربری گرافیکی بین انسان و ماشین هستند که اطلاعاتی مانند وضعیت فرآیندها، هشدارها و داده های کنترلی را به صورت بصری نمایش میدهند. برنامه نویسی این پنل ها امکان شخصی سازی صفحات نمایش، تنظیمات ورودی/خروجی، و ارتباط با سایر تجهیزات مانند PLC را فراهم میکند.

دلایل برنامه نویسی پنل زیمنس:

• ایجاد صفحات گرافیکی متناسب با فرآیند.
• نمایش داده های حیاتی به صورت لحظه ای.
• تعریف عملیات کنترلی برای اپراتورها.
• ایجاد هشدارها و اعلانها در شرایط خاص.

ابزارهای برنامه نویسی پنل زیمنس

برای برنامه نویسی HMI زیمنس، نیاز به ابزارهای سخت افزاری و نرم افزاری زیر دارید:

الف) سخت افزار

  • پنل HMI زیمنس : مدل هایی مانند TP900 Comfort ، KTP700 Basic یا TP1500 Comfort.
  • PLC زیمنس : به عنوان کنترلر اصلی برای تبادل داده با.HMI
  •  کابل ارتباطی: بسته به مدلHMI ، از کابلهای Ethernet یا PROFINET استفاده میشود.

ب) نرم افزار

• :(TIA Portal )Totally Integrated Automationنرم افزار اصلی برای طراحی و برنامه نویسی HMI زیمنس.
• :(WinCC )Windows Control Center ابزار طراحی گرافیکی صفحات HMI که در TIA Portal ادغام شده است.
• درایور ارتباطی: برای برقراری ارتباط بین رایانه و پنل.HMI

مراحل برنامه نویسی پنل زیمنس

نصب و راه اندازی TIA Portal

• TIA Portalرا از وبسایت رسمی زیمنس دانلود و نصب کنید.
• پروژه جدیدی در TIA Portal ایجاد کنید و مدل پنل HMI خود را انتخاب کنید.
• اتصال پنل HMI و PLC را از طریق تنظیمات شبکه PROFINET) یا (Ethernet پیکربندی کنید.

تعریف ارتباطات بین HMI و PLC

• در محیط TIA Portal ، PLC و HMI را به یک شبکه یکپارچه متصل کنید.

• پارامترهای ارتباطی مانند آدرس IP و نوع ارتباط را تنظیم کنید.
• متغیرهای PLC را برای استفاده در HMI تعریف کنید (به عنوان مثال: دما، فشار، حالت سیستم).

طراحی صفحات گرافیکی

  • ایجاد صفحه اصلی (Main Screen) :
  •  اضافه کردن المان هایی مانند نمایشگر اعداد(Numeric Display) ، کلیدها (Buttons) و نمودارها.(Trends)
  •  اضافه کردن صفحات اضافی:
  •  صفحات مختلف برای تنظیمات، گزارشها یا گرافهای خاص ایجاد کنید.
  • افزودن متغیرها:
  •  متغیرهای تعریفشده در PLC را به المان های گرافیکی پیوند دهید.

تنظیم هشدارها(Alarms) :

1. از ابزار شبیه ساز داخلی TIA Portal برای تست برنامه استفاده کنید.
2. مطمئن شوید صفحات به درستی نمایش داده میشوند و ارتباط با PLC برقرار است.
3. مشکلات احتمالی را برطرف کنید.

انتقال برنامه به پنل HMI

1. کابل ارتباطی را به پنل HMI متصل کنید.
2. برنامه را از طریق گزینه Download to Device به پنل منتقل کنید.
3. عملکرد پنل را در محیط واقعی تست کنید.

نکات کلیدی در برنامه نویسی پنل زیمنس

• رنگ بندی استاندارد : از رنگ های مشخص برای نمایش هشدارها (مانند قرمز برای خطر و سبز برای حالت نرمال) استفاده کنید.
• استفاده از ماکروها : برای عملیات پیچیده تر، از توابع و ماکروهای اختصاصی استفاده کنید.

برنامه نویسی پنل زیمنس در صنعت

.1صنایع تولیدی

در خطوط تولید، HMIها برای نمایش وضعیت ماشین آلات، کنترل سرعت خطوط و نمایش خطاها استفاده میشوند.

.2صنایع نفت و گاز

در تأسیسات پالایشگاهی، HMI ها نقش مهمی در مانیتورینگ دما، فشار و سطوح مخازن ایفا میکنند.

.3صنایع غذایی و دارویی

HMI ها برای کنترل فرآیندهای حساس مانند دما و رطوبت در تولید مواد غذایی و دارویی به کارمیروند.

.4نیروگاهها و صنایع انرژی

نمایش داده های مربوط به تولید برق، نظارت بر توربین ها و کنترل از راه دور از طریق HMI انجام میشود.

برنامه نویسی پنل زیمنس

1. هماهنگی با : PLC در پروژه های بزرگ، هماهنگی دقیق بین HMI و PLC ضروری است.

2. سرعت نمایش داده ه ا: در سیستم های بلادرنگ (Real-Time) ، تأخیر در نمایش داده ها میتواند مشکل ساز شود.

3. آموزش کاربر نهایی: طراحی پنل باید به گونه ای باشد که اپراتورها به راحتی بتوانند با آن کار کنند.

نکته پایانی

برنامه نویسی پنل زیمنس یکی از مهمترین مهارتهای مهندسی اتوماسیون صنعتی است که نیازمند تسلط بر ابزارهایی مانند TIA Portal و مفاهیم ارتباطی بین HMI و PLC است. با رعایت مراحل و نکات مطرح شده در این مقاله، میتوانید پنل هایی کارآمد و حرفه ای طراحی کنید که نقش کلیدی در بهینه سازی فرآیندهای صنعتی ایفا میکنند.

بدون دیدگاه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*